1969 Alfa Romeo GT vs. 1994 Renault 21

To start off, 1994 Renault 21 is newer by 25 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1969 Alfa Romeo GT.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1969 Alfa Romeo GT would be higher. At 1,719 cc (4 cylinders), 1994 Renault 21 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1969 Alfa Romeo GT (103 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 28 more horse power than 1994 Renault 21. (75 HP @ 5000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1969 Alfa Romeo GT should accelerate faster than 1994 Renault 21.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1969 Alfa Romeo GT weights approximately 15 kg more than 1994 Renault 21.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1969 Alfa Romeo GT is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1969 Alfa Romeo GT.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1994 Renault 21,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1969 Alfa Romeo GT (137 Nm @ 3200 RPM) has 8 more torque (in Nm) than 1994 Renault 21. (129 Nm @ 3250 RPM). This means 1969 Alfa Romeo GT will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1994 Renault 21.
